Understanding the Modern Latin Lover
The image of the "Latin Lover" has evolved. Gone are the days of simple, one-dimensional characters. Today's audience craves depth, complexity, and nuanced portrayals that explore the richness of Latin American cultures and identities. Your film needs to reflect this shift.
Beyond the Stereotype:
- Authenticity over Archetype: Avoid relying on tired stereotypes. Instead, focus on creating a well-rounded character with unique flaws, aspirations, and relationships.
- Cultural Nuance: Research and accurately represent the specific cultural background you're portraying. Consult with cultural consultants to ensure authenticity and avoid misrepresentation. This applies to language, customs, and social dynamics.
- Modern Relationships: Explore contemporary relationships. The modern Latin lover isn't defined by outdated gender roles. Show dynamic interactions, healthy relationships, and emotional intelligence.
- Avoiding Harmful Tropes: Be mindful of potentially harmful stereotypes like the "Macho Man" or the "Exotic Other." Subvert these tropes by creating a character that challenges expectations.
Crafting a Compelling Narrative
Your film's storyline is crucial. It needs to engage audiences and provide a reason to connect with your "Latin Lover" character.
Strong Story Arc:
- Character Development: The journey of your character is key. Show his growth, struggles, and triumphs. This will create empathy and a deeper connection with the audience.
- Relatable Themes: Incorporate universal themes such as love, loss, family, and self-discovery. This will broaden the appeal of your film.
- Conflict and Resolution: Develop a compelling narrative arc with internal and external conflicts that ultimately lead to satisfying resolutions.
- Emotional Resonance: Aim to evoke genuine emotions in your audience. This can be achieved through strong performances, compelling dialogue, and impactful visuals.
Production and Casting
The success of your film heavily depends on your production choices and the talent involved.
Casting and Performance:
- Authentic Casting: Choose actors who embody the cultural background you're portraying. Authenticity resonates powerfully with audiences.
- Subtlety in Performance: Avoid over-the-top portrayals. Nuance and subtlety in acting can create a more believable and compelling character.
- Collaborative Approach: Work closely with your cast and crew to develop the character and the film's overall vision.
